What Really Happens During Chinese New Year
global supply chain disruptions don’t always come from chaos. Sometimes, they come from tradition.
Chinese New Year follows a different calendar, which means it doesn’t align with the standard January reset most businesses operate on.
But the timing isn’t the real issue. The scale is.
China plays a central role in global manufacturing. A large portion of the world’s raw materials, packaging, and finished goods originate there. When operations slow down, everything connected to that system feels it.
During this period, factories don’t just slow. They stop.
Workers leave. Production halts. Logistics pause.
This shutdown can last for weeks.
For prepared businesses, it’s manageable. They plan ahead. They stock inventory. They build buffers.
For everyone else, delays start stacking.
When Predictable Meets Unpredictable
Now layer something unexpected on top of that.
The Suez Canal blockage is a perfect example.
A single cargo ship halted one of the most important trade routes in the world. Not slowed down. Completely blocked.
Over 18,000 containers sat in transit. Ships lined up. Routes changed. Costs increased.
The damage reached nearly a billion dollars.
But the real impact wasn’t just financial.
It was delay compounding delay.
Inventory didn’t arrive. Production timelines shifted. Businesses that were already waiting… waited longer.
